This guide covers the management and editing of permissions for the Controller Dashboard view. The guide describes how to edit the default dashboard and how the modified dashboard is saved to your own reports. Additionally, the guide explains how to download the dashboard to Excel or PDF format.

General

Permissions for the Dashboard view are restricted per user from the User Management page. You can grant either Read or Edit permissions to the view, or no permissions at all.

The Dashboard page by default has a "standard dashboard" which includes "Figures" such as revenue, operating profit, fiscal year result, and cash and bank receivables. In addition, the standard dashboard includes "Charts" such as revenue, operating profit, and fiscal year result. 

If the default dashboard view is edited, it simultaneously becomes a new personal report in the My Reports view and is marked as a standard dashboard visible on the "Dashboard" tab. Other reports can also be set as the default dashboard on the Dashboard tab through My Reports. This is done via the report's three dots "Set as Dashboard":

Each user can also have their own dashboards, which are saved to their own reports. However, the default dashboard on the Dashboard tab is always company-specific, meaning it appears the same to all users. The default dashboard can always be restored from the settings menu via the three dots "Restore defaults":

NOTE! Default dashboards (Dashboard tab) are currently only visible to companies using the basic account list. Associations can create their own key figures and dashboards that meet their needs through "My Reports". Editing the dashboard

Editing the dashboard begins from the top right corner of the view via the "Edit report" button. You can give the dashboard a desired name from the top left corner. Tables, Charts, Figures, or Notes can be added to the view via the "Add element" button using the same logic as in My Reports. Detailed instructions for adding elements can be found here: Elements

In edit mode, it is possible to drag the elements of the dashboard view and change the size of tables as desired. Page breaks are visible in the view for printing purposes. Individual elements are edited either via the element's three dots or the "Edit meter" button. Tables are edited directly from the table. The periods, figures, comparison figures, and calculation targets of elements can be edited and added element-wise.


Downloading the dashboard

The dashboard can be downloaded to Excel via the report's three dots. Charts and tables from the elements can be exported to Excel. 

The dashboard can be downloaded in PDF format either as a report view or element-wise.

In element-wise printing, you can choose which elements you want to download and how many elements per page. The print orientation is also selectable.
